•Who are our key stakeholders?

•What are their needs?

•What is the G.A.P. between stakeholder needs and results?

•How do we routinely measure, analyze, and improve results?

•Are people held accountable and rewarded for results?

•How well are we meeting stakeholder needs?

•Do we have survey results of satisfaction:Residents/families?Employees?

•Do we have broken or unclear work flow processes? Look for redundancy, rework, waste.

•Are departments aligned with common goals preventing bickering, and non-cooperation?

•Do we have the right people? Are they aligned with our goals?

•What are we doing to recruit & retain the best talent?

•What are we doing to develop our people?

•Are mission, vision, and values known and embraced?

•What are our strategic objectives/priorities?

• Do we trust our leaders?

• How well do they communicate

• Do they drive each element of this leadership cycle?

Phase 1: Focus Phase 2: Align Phase 3: Execute

Phase 4: Review

Pre-Work• Read Good to Great• Pre-planning prep with CEO to:

– Create agenda for planning session– Create draft Strategic Objectives &

Scorecard– Agree on scope & schedule of

implementation

2-day Strategic Planning Session with Leadership Team

• If involve the board, usually they join for Day 1

• Understand stakeholders needs• Do S.W.O.T.• Agree on Strategic Objectives

– 4 or 5 broad statements of priority– 1 to 5 year time horizon

Continue 2-day Strategic Planning

• Day 2 with leadership team

• Build Scorecard• Set Goals

– 2 or 3 under each Objective

– 1 year time horizon

• Create Action Plans– Aligned with

Goals – Get specific

about who will do what & when

• Cascade goal setting to other business units, locations, or facilities

Execute Action Plans

• Leaders execute Action Plans

• Progress is documented in F&E web tool

Board Approve Strategic Plan – Give the “Green Light”

• 30 days later, leaders meet to share their completed plans

• Leaders also report progress on their Goals & Action Plans

• Leaders prepare for this meeting by having their plans updated

• CEO reviews, reinforces, holds leaders accountable

• Outcomes: – 100% alignment– What gets measured improves

• Present final plan to board for approval & get “green light”

Monthly or Quarterly Business Review

• 30 days after Green Light Meeting• Leadership Team continues to

review progress in F&E web tool on a Monthly or Quarterly basis
